3. Material Options and Durability
Contemporary foldable and stackable café chairs are both durable & stylish. They are available in a variety of materials to complement a variety of design styles:
Metal: Powder-coated aluminum or steel provides durability and weather resistance, great for use outside.
Plastic/Polypropylene: Durable and simple to clean, plastic chairs are great for casual cafés and patios.
Wood: Options of treated wood give a warm, natural appearance while still being foldable or stackable for indoor and outdoor areas.
Sturdy building makes these chairs to handle repetitive handling and storage without compromising stability.
